Detecting High-Quality GAN-Generated Face Images using Neural Networks. (arXiv:2203.01716v1 [cs.CR])
March 4, 2022, 2:20 a.m. | Ehsan Nowroozi, Mauro Conti, Yassine Mekdad
cs.CR updates on arXiv.org arxiv.org
In the past decades, the excessive use of the last-generation GAN (Generative
Adversarial Networks) models in computer vision has enabled the creation of
artificial face images that are visually indistinguishable from genuine ones.
These images are particularly used in adversarial settings to create fake
social media accounts and other fake online profiles. Such malicious activities
can negatively impact the trustworthiness of users identities. On the other
hand, the recent development of GAN models may create high-quality face images
